CLI Commands config.security.fabricBinding.deleteMember Syntax deleteMember wwn domainId Purpose This command removes a member from the Fabric Member List in the pending fabric binding work area. NOTE: Changes are not activated to the fabric until the activatePending command is issued. Parameters This command has two parameters: wwn domainId Specifies the WWN of the member to be removed from the fabric membership list. The value of the WWN must be in colon-delimited hexadecimal notation (for example, AA:00:AA:00:AA:00:AA:00). The domain ID of the member to be removed from the fabric membership list. Valid domain ID's range from 1 to 31.
